Gods and Goddesses
• The names of the main gods/goddesses are Aphrodite, Apollo, Artemis, Athena, Ares, Hephaestus, Hera, Hermes, Hades, Hestia, Poseidon, and Zeus.
Zeus, Hades, and Poseidon
• Zeus, Hades, and Poseidon were all brothers and they all own a part of the world

Greek Heroes
• Some Greek heroes are Achilles, Hercules, Theseus, Odysseus, Perseus, and Jason.
• Zeus= god of the sky. Hades= god of the underworld Poseidon= god of the sea Athena= goddess of wisdom Ares= god of war Hestia= goddess of the hearth
• Apollo= the god of sun and music, poetry, and healing Hera= goddess or marriage Aphrodite= goddess of love Hephaestus= the god of the forge Artemis= the goddess of nature Hermes= the god of thieves, messaging, and travel
• The Greek Gods impacted their daily lives by having them make sacrifices for them and gave them something to worship in their daily lives
